We could have kept Hamilton, says Dennis

Ron Dennis, former McLaren Team Principal and now Executive Chairman of McLaren Automotive, has revealed that the team could have retained Lewis Hamilton for the 2013 campaign, but instead opted not to. The 2008 World Champion announced a three-year agreement with rivals Mercedes last September. Brazil 2012: Hamilton's last outing for McLaren'I think it’s wrong to portray that Lewis left this team,' Dennis explained to CBI Magazine. 'At the end of the day, you end up with a situation where you’re going to separate if the circumstances aren’t right. Life isn’t about one person deciding anything. It’s never that way.
